Explanation:
Sedimentary rocks are types of rock that are formed by the accumulation or deposition of mineral or organic particles at the Earth's surface, followed by cementation. Sedimentation is the collective name for processes that cause these particles to settle in place. The particles that form a sedimentary rock are called sediment, and may be composed of geological detritus (minerals) or biological detritus (organic matter). The geological detritus originated from weathering and erosion of existing rocks, or from the solidification of molten lava blobs erupted by volcanoes. The geological detritus is transported to the place of deposition by water, wind, ice or mass movement, which are called agents of denudation. Biological detritus was formed by bodies and parts (mainly shells) of dead aquatic organisms, as well as their fecal mass, suspended in water and slowly piling up on the floor of water bodies (marine snow). Sedimentation may also occur as dissolved minerals precipitate from water solution.

Sickle cell anemia disorder does not result from non disjunction in meiosis. So, the correct option is D.
What is Sickle cell anemia?Sickle cell anemias are defined as a group of disorders that cause red blood cells to become malformed and break down.
With sickle cell disease, an inherited group of disorders, red blood cells are twisted into a sickle shape in which the cells die early, leading to a shortage of healthy red blood cells i.e. sickle cell anemia and blockage of blood flow which can cause pain i.e. sickle cell anemia cell crisis.
Infections, pain and fatigue are symptoms of sickle cell disease. This disease is not the result from non disjunction in meiosis like other diseases such as Down syndrome, Tuners syndrome, etc.
Thus, Sickle cell anemia disorder does not result from non disjunction in meiosis. So, the correct option is D.

What is the relationship between Rate of Enzyme Reaction and temperature?
Like most chemical reactions, the rate of an enzyme-catalyzed reaction increases as the temperature is raised. A ten degree Centigrade rise in temperature will increase the activity of most enzymes by 50 to 100%.
